Echoes of Rage: Kenku Barbarian Character

The Kenku Barbarian presents a uniquely challenging and fulfilling roleplaying experience in D&D. Plagued by their inability to utter original copyright, and driven by primal rage , these avian humanoids must find new ways to convey their combat prowess. Building a successful Kenku Barbarian requires careful thought of their backstory and how their ancestry shapes their martial style. They often possess a history of tragedy , fueling their uncontrollable rage, and their mimicry can be employed to both confuse enemies and achieve tactical advantages. Here's a look at key aspects to consider:

  • Origin : Develop a compelling reason for your Kenku's departure from their flock.
  • Expression : Explore how your Kenku relies on gestures, mimicry, and few vocalizations to interact.
  • Ire: Determine what sparks your Kenku's devastating rage.
  • Battle Style: How does your Kenku's restricted communication impact their tactics to conflict ?
